Output 163ac53cd72ddf99ceaffbab277103d1d13224625916f4166ac03a83b0051435:21

value
135599469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c80d4bd35d290979822864ad76284ed9b02ca6d OP_EQUAL
address
MBxUJCvW5z4bny5BCFvnTxeiUH3iytxGFm
transaction
163ac53cd72ddf99ceaffbab277103d1d13224625916f4166ac03a83b0051435
spent
true